Photovoltaic Energy Storage Systems For homes or businesses that need to store electricity, PV storage systems typically have a service life of 10 to 15 years, depending on the choice of battery type, such as lithium or lead-acid batteries. Overall, the effective lifespan of a solar power system depends on the lifespan of the individual components.
Solar panels have a remarkable lifespan, typically lasting 25-30 years, with many continuing to function beyond this period at reduced efficiency. This longevity makes solar panels a sustainable energy technology. Over this operational period, panels gradually lose efficiency, a process known as degradation.
1. Lifetime of photovoltaic modules Standard lifetime of PV modules: 25 to 30 years Modern PV modules typically have a lifespan of between 25 and 30 years, which means that within this timeframe, the PV module is still able to provide an effective power output.
Inverters, essential for converting DC to AC power, usually have shorter lifespans than solar panels. String inverters operate effectively for 10-15 years, while microinverters can exceed 20 years due to their advanced design and resilience.
